I need to interface an AD7606B to a Linux system based on NXP iMX93 in order to achieve a sampling frequency of 50kSps for each of the 8 channels. I read that you interpose an FPGA between the linux system and the ADCs in order to achieve higher speed (i tryed the AD7606B directly connected to the iMX93 but i had a non-costant sampling rate).

Right now a cannot add an FPGA to my board but i have a high speed extern microcontroller. Can I interpose this between the two devices? I know how to sample the ADC with the microcontroller, but in case i would like to use the SPI engine driver (https://wiki.analog.com/resources/tools-software/linux-drivers/spi/spi_engine), what do i need to insert in the firmware to achieve this?
